Job Overview The Vice President, Workforce Management is a leader responsible for the execution and optimization of workforce management practices across LPL's Service organization. This role ensures the organization has the right resources deployed at the right time to deliver exceptional client experiences while achieving service level, productivity, and employee experience objectives. Reporting to the SVP, Capacity, Workforce Management & Operations Planning, the VP serves as the operational leader for workforce management execution, translating strategic workforce planning priorities into scalable processes, tools, and operating disciplines. The role oversees workforce management functions including scheduling, intraday management, real-time operations, performance monitoring, and workforce optimization across multiple service channels.
Responsibilities • Develop and lead the execution of the workforce management strategy across all Service channels ensuring alignment with enterprise objectives, service commitments, and operational priorities
• Own workforce management operations , including scheduling, real-time management, service level performance, schedule adherence, occupancy, and workforce optimization.
• Translate strategic workforce priorities into scalable operating practices, governance routines, and performance expectations across the Service organization.
• Drive achievement of workforce management and service performance goals through proactive monitoring, performance management, and risk mitigation.
• Own the strategic roadmap for workforce management technologies , including AI enablement, NICE IEX, and equivalent platforms.
• Establish performance dashboards, metrics, and reporting routines that provide actionable insights and drive accountability throughout the organization.
• Collaborate closely with Service, Operations, Capacity Planning, Forecasting, Finance, Technology, and Human Resources leaders to ensure workforce execution supports business priorities and client demand.
• Lead continuous improvement efforts that enhance workforce flexibility, operational scalability, service quality, and productivity across all supported functions.
• Build, develop, and lead a high-performing workforce management team while fostering a culture of accountability, innovation, collaboration, and operational excellence.

Requirements: • Bachelor's degree in Business, Analytics, Operations Management, or related discipline.
• 12+ years of experience in workforce management, contact center operations, service operations, or related functions.

Your recruiter will be happy to discuss all that LPL has to offer! Company Overview: LPL Financial Holdings Inc. (Nasdaq: LPLA) is among the fastest growing wealth management firms in the U.S. As a leader in the financial advisor-mediated marketplace(6) , LPL supports over 32,000 financial advisors and the wealth management practices of approximately 1,100 financial institutions, servicing and custodying approximately $2.3 trillion in brokerage and advisory assets on behalf of approximately 8 million Americans.
